In 1982 the world of Welsh rugby was deprived of one of its best-loved members by the death of Carwyn James.He was the first man to coach a victorious British Lions team this century,also achieved unparalleled success as coach to the Welsh champion club Llanelli,and was frequently described as the greatest coach in the world.Yet he never coached the Welsh team and was regarded as a prophet without honour in his own country. Carwyn James was a complex man whose refusal to conform made him an aloof outsider in a cosy world of insiders.In public,as assured television broadcaster and rugby analyst,the 'Guardian' columnist who adored Neville Cardus, in private he was a modest,shy man who constantly sought to underplay his abilities. Yet he was a fine journalist and broadcaster and an incomparable coach whose contribution to British rugby will never be forgotten. Alun Richards biography is a very personal memoir of a man whom he regards as more of an artist than a sportsman,a rugby aesthete who nevertheless had the steel to succeed in a most competitive world. It is a rich,warm,humorous account of the life of a man who has variously been described as 'the intellectual Welsh legend','the greatest rugby academic that Welsh rugby has ever known' and 'the prince of coaches'.It is entirely fitting that this tribute should come from the pen of one of Wales's best contemporary novelists.An uncommon title.
